Analysis

In 2023, inbound mobility rate, female (uis estimate) in ESCAP: Wb Upper Middle Income Economies (wb_upper_mid) (unsdcode:98437) stood at 0.6%.

That represents a change of down 1.6% on the previous year and up 62.6% over ten years.

Over the whole period, inbound mobility rate, female (uis estimate) in ESCAP: Wb Upper Middle Income Economies (wb_upper_mid) (unsdcode:98437) peaked at 0.6% in 2022 and was at its lowest, 0.2%, in 2006.

That places ESCAP: Wb Upper Middle Income Economies (wb_upper_mid) (unsdcode:98437) 180th out of 201 groups with data for 2023, putting it in the bottom quarter.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 19 years of available data.
